When Ponds Freeze Over is an interesting exploration of memory and familial bonds, all wrapped in animation that feels both raw and tender. The pacing is reflective, allowing you to sit with Mary's memories as she shares the chilling tale of her and her father's accident on the ice. The visuals, while simple, evoke a nostalgic atmosphere that resonates with the themes of loss and resilience. The performances feel genuine, especially the way the characters' emotions are depicted through their expressions. It’s distinctive for its ability to blend a childhood adventure with deeper emotional undercurrents, making you think about how our past shapes us. Not your typical animated fare, that's for sure.
